The Colorado Department of Transportation (CDOT) will begin a highway resurfacing project Monday on Highway 69, stretching from Hillside to Texas Creek.

The project will include resurfacing both the northbound and southbound lanes, construction of a maintenance pull-off, installation of new guardrails, as well as fresh striping and updated signage along the corridor.

Work is scheduled to run Monday through Friday from 7 a.m. to 7 p.m., with the project expected to be completed in August.

During construction, traffic will be reduced to a single lane with alternating traffic, and delays of up to 15 minutesare possible for drivers traveling through the work zone. Motorists are encouraged to plan ahead and allow extra travel time while the project is underway.
